Feasibility and efficacy of combined modality intervention using chemotherapeutic agent gemcitabine with anti-angiogenic peptide vaccination targeting VRGFR1 should be determined in case of advanced/inoperable or therapy-resistant pancreatic cancer patients.
Gemcitabine 1,000mg/m2 BSA will be administered on day1, day8, day15, day29, day36, day43, respectively.
HLA-A*2402-restricted VEGFR1-derived peptide (VEGFR1-A24-1084; SYGVLLWEI) emulsified with Montanide ISA51 will be subcutaneously injected twice weekly for 8weeks (total 16 doses).
HLA-A*2402-restricted cytotoxic T lymphocyte (CTL) clones were obtained from healthy volunteer donor peripheral blood.
These CTL clones showed potent cytotoxicities selectively against VEGFR1-expressing target cells in HLA-class I-restricted manner.

| VEGFR1-A24-1084 (SYGVLLWEI) | Biological | HLA-A*2402-restricted VEGFR1-derived peptide (VEGFR1-A24-1084) 1mg emulsified with Montanide ISA51 will be subcutaneously injected 2 times weekly for total 16doses concurrently with conventional dose of gemcitabine 1,000mg/m2 BSA on 1st, 2nd, 3rd, 5th, 6th, 7th weeks for advanced/inoperable pancreatic cancer patients. |
